About the studio — craft, materials, and process

Our studio was founded by furniture makers and interior specialists who value the dialogue between material and function. We begin projects with an in-depth consultation to understand spatial constraints, user habits, and stylistic intentions. Schematic sketches and 3D visuals help clients see how a piece will sit in the room; we proceed to full-scale prototypes for complex joinery or ergonomically sensitive elements. Material recommendations are grounded in longevity: hardwood species are selected for their mechanical properties and finish response, while engineered alternatives are used when dimensional stability or cost management is paramount. The build phase combines hand-fitting with precision machining—CNC for repetitive accuracy, hand-planed surfaces for tactile quality—and culminates in surface finishing choices that range from natural oils and waxes to hard-wearing catalyzed lacquers depending on the intended use. On-site installation is treated as the final craft stage: careful leveling, concealed fixings, and seamless transitions to adjacent finishes result in a coherent, high-quality outcome.

Sustainability is integrated into our procurement and waste practices. We prefer reclaimed or FSC-certified timbers where feasible, optimize panel nesting to reduce waste, and source locally milled material to reduce transport impact. Finishes are chosen with indoor air quality in mind and we offer low-VOC options for clients prioritizing healthy interiors. For commercial clients, we document maintenance recommendations and provide warranty information to protect both owner investment and occupant safety.
